High street bank lending to SMEs remains stable in Q2

Latest UK Finance data shows that overall gross lending was broadly stable at around £4 billion in Q2 2024. Asset finance grew by 9% in July 2024

13th September 2024 Asset Finance | #asset finance

New figures released by the Finance & Leasing Association (FLA) show that total asset finance new business (primarily leasing and hire purchase) grew in July 2024 by 9% compared with the same month in 2023.  In the seven months to July 2024, new business was 5% higher than in the same period in 2023. Asset finance fell by 7% in June

New figures released by the Finance & Leasing Association (FLA) show that total asset finance new business (primarily leasing and hire purchase) fell in June 2024 by 7% compared with the same month in 2023.  In the first half of 2024, new business was 5% higher than in the same period in 2023.
